What Was the Timeline of Justin Bieber’s Last Tour?
The last time Justin Bieber hit the road was during the Justice World Tour, which commenced in 2022. Unfortunately, this tour faced premature cancellation due to serious health concerns, including the diagnosis of Ramsay Hunt Syndrome, which significantly impacted his ability to perform.
In a heartfelt message, he expressed, “Earlier this year, I went public about my battle with Ramsay Hunt Syndrome, where my face was partly paralyzed.” He went on to explain that due to this debilitating condition, he could not finish the North American leg of the Justice Tour, highlighting the importance of prioritizing his health and recovery.
At that time, Bieber emphasized the necessity of focusing on his healing journey after experiencing partial facial paralysis. His recent appearances at Coachella 2026 marked a significant milestone as they represented his major return to live performances, hinting at an exciting new chapter in his musical career and potential future tours.
Is Justin Bieber Planning a Tour in 2026?
Currently, Justin Bieber has not made any official announcements regarding a 2026 tour. Nevertheless, the excitement surrounding his recent comeback at Coachella has sparked widespread speculation about his possible return to the touring scene.
His official website has hinted at the possibility of upcoming tour dates, while reports indicate that he has been gradually reintroducing himself to performing through smaller, intimate appearances, all while ensuring he remains focused on his health. While nothing is confirmed yet, these signs of renewed activity have fans eagerly anticipating an official announcement about his next tour.
